Production Excellence: A Career in Production Engineering

A career in production engineering presents a unique opportunity to integrate technical expertise with the dynamic realm of manufacturing. These professionals are responsible for streamlining processes, minimizing waste, and improving overall output. Production engineers utilize their knowledge of industrial operations to develop innovative solutions that maximize production capacity while maintaining the highest quality of product quality.

Their responsibilities can encompass everything from executing time studies to implementing new technologies, and from diagnosing production issues to working with cross-functional teams. A career in production engineering is a constantly transforming field that demands a dedication for continuous learning and improvement.

From Concept to Creation: The Role of Production Engineers

Production engineers serve as the vital role of bridging the gap between groundbreaking concepts and tangible products. Their expertise encompasses a wide variety of disciplines, such as manufacturing processes, material science, and quality control. From initial design stages get more info to the final production, production engineers guarantee that products are created efficiently, effectively, and consistently. They work together with designers, engineers, and other stakeholders to refine production methods, reduce costs, and boost product quality. By applying their specialized knowledge and problem-solving skills, production engineers play a crucial role to the success of any manufacturing endeavor.
